This LPS (Plerogyridae) coral is rated moderate difficulty and requires PAR levels of 50–150 with low flow. It responds well to target feeding with meaty foods like Mysis and reef roids. Best placed in the lower rock, sheltered area of the tank, it has high (sweeper) aggression.

Besoins en lumière
Provide PAR levels of 50–150 µmol for optimal health and coloration. Moderate accuracy in lighting is sufficient, but consistency matters more than hitting exact numbers. When first placing the coral, start with lower light intensity and gradually increase over 1–2 weeks to prevent light shock.
Spectrum matters as well: a mix of blue (420–480 nm) and white light produces the best fluorescence and growth. Many hobbyists run heavier blue spectrums to enhance coral fluorescence while maintaining enough PAR for photosynthesis.
Besoins en courant
Low to gentle flow is ideal. Too much flow will prevent polyps from fully extending and can cause tissue stress. Position the coral in a sheltered area behind rockwork or in a lower-flow zone of the tank. Some gentle movement is beneficial for gas exchange and waste removal, but the polyps should not be constantly whipped around.
Placement
Place this coral in the lower rock, sheltered area of your aquascape. Warning: This coral has aggressive sweeper tentacles that can extend several inches at night, stinging and killing neighboring corals. Leave at least 4–6 inches of clearance on all sides. Check at night with a flashlight to see the full reach of sweeper tentacles.
Secure the coral to rockwork using reef-safe gel super glue or epoxy. Ensure it is stable and won't topple—falling corals get stressed and damaged. Let the glue cure briefly before returning the frag to the tank.
Nourrissage
This coral benefits significantly from target feeding. Use a turkey baster or pipette to deliver small meaty foods directly to the polyps: finely chopped Mysis shrimp, Reef-Roids, or Benepets work well. Feed 2–3 times per week after lights dim, when tentacles are most extended. Target-fed specimens grow noticeably faster and display better coloration than those relying solely on photosynthesis.
Bouturage
Fragging LPS corals requires more care than soft corals. Use a Dremel rotary tool or bone cutters to separate heads along the skeletal divisions. Avoid cutting through live tissue whenever possible. Dip the fresh cut in iodine solution to prevent infection, then attach to a frag plug with super glue or epoxy. Recovery takes 1–4 weeks. Do not frag stressed or unhealthy colonies.
Problèmes courants
- Tissue recession or bleaching: Usually caused by unstable parameters, excessive light, or chemical aggression from neighboring corals. Investigate recent changes in lighting, dosing, or new coral additions.
- Failure to extend polyps: Check flow strength (too strong?), lighting intensity, and water quality. Recent dipping or transport stress can also cause temporary retraction.
- Pests: Inspect for flatworms, nudibranchs, or other parasites. A prophylactic coral dip (Coral Rx, Bayer) upon introduction prevents most pest issues.
- Slow growth: Ensure adequate feeding, stable alkalinity (8–11 dKH), calcium (400–450 ppm), and magnesium (1300–1400 ppm). SPS corals especially need stable, consistent alkalinity for skeleton building.
Questions fréquentes
Is this coral good for beginners?
This coral is suitable for intermediate reef keepers who have stable water parameters and some experience with coral care. Beginners should start with easier species and work up to this one.
What PAR level does this coral need?
Aim for PAR levels of 50–150 µmol at the coral's position. Use a PAR meter to verify actual light levels in your tank, as fixture specs and manufacturer claims often differ from real-world measurements.
How fast does this coral grow?
Growth rate is slow. Factors that influence growth include lighting intensity, flow, feeding regimen, and stable water chemistry. Consistent alkalinity and calcium are the primary drivers of calcification rate in stony corals.
